Isaiah 42:3

Context

42:3 A crushed reed he will not break,

a dim wick he will not extinguish; 1 

he will faithfully make just decrees. 2 

Isaiah 43:17

Context

43:17 the one who led chariots and horses to destruction, 3 

together with a mighty army.

They fell down, 4  never to rise again;

they were extinguished, put out like a burning wick:

[42:3]  1 sn The “crushed reed” and “dim wick” symbolize the weak and oppressed who are on the verge of extinction.

[42:3]  2 tn Heb “faithfully he will bring out justice” (cf. NASB, NRSV).

[43:17]  3 tn Heb “led out chariots and horses.” The words “to destruction” are supplied in the translation for clarification. The verse refers to the destruction of the Egyptians at the Red Sea.

[43:17]  4 tn Heb “lay down”; NAB “lie prostrate together”; CEV “lie dead”; NRSV “they lie down.”
